Output 73768bfc231437df064c261b677f9eeb8b36a9d9b76111ed2cf6c10464f633e5:1

value
22480637
script pubkey
OP_0 OP_PUSHBYTES_20 d7ef2c51de4780c2404c9d6fdc0c7823a45da4aa
address
bc1q6lhjc5w7g7qvyszvn4hacrrcywj9mf92fpyee9
transaction
73768bfc231437df064c261b677f9eeb8b36a9d9b76111ed2cf6c10464f633e5
spent
true